There is a company that is out of UK Maxton-Design (https://maxtondesign.com/product-eng-8312-Front-Splitter-Audi-RS6-C5.html) that makes it in Carbon Look. You can order online directly from them and they will make it for you. Mine came in 8 weeks or so, but that was before Covid-19 was keeping us at home. Also I ordered front splitter, side skirts, and rear aprons. Because the rear aprons they did not have in stock I asked to wait to ship it all together.

I ordered mine in textured and brought it to a shop to paint it the same color as the car. But you can get Textured, Gloss Black, or Carbon Look.
The stickers are not on the pieces. They come separately and you can choose to put them on. I did not attach the stickers.

Just a cautionary note...with the maxton you have to drill into the bumper, the other one is a press fit. I agree that the Maxton kit looks good

This is a correct statement. The Maxton pieces require drilling bumper, side skirt or rear bumper depending on which pieces you want to install.
Worth keeping in mind for those considering this option. My wife and I installed all pieces on a Saturday. Took us a bit of time as we started early and finished by late afternoon. When installing front lip spoiler you have to take plastic shroud/pan that covers center of the bottom of the engine to access the bumper inner section. Just plan your drilling accordingly.
I got some double sided tape just to add some buffer between plastic pieces.

Correct, double sided tape and stainless self tapping screws.
Mines been on about 4 years and it still looks like it was put on yesterday.
I've even scraped the front numerous times and it's held up well. Much easier to swallow replacing the front maxton if ever damaged versus a very expensive carbon piece.
